The coolant temperature sensor monitors engine coolant temperature and sends that reading to the ECM, which uses it to adjust fuel delivery, ignition timing, and cooling fan operation. Signs of failure include: a check engine light with a coolant temperature code, the temperature gauge reading incorrectly, the engine running rich or lean, or the cooling fans not activating at the correct temperature. Replace a faulty sensor to restore proper engine management.
